In cases where many people need access and some keys are unaccounted for, consider contacting &amp;lt;a  href=&amp;quot;https://locksmithunit.com/&amp;quot; &amp;gt;local Orlando locksmiths&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; for an on-site quote and timeline for rekeying.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Explaining rekeying and why it is often the right first step.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Rekeying alters the cylinder so a new key is required and previous keys will be useless. Because the physical lock remains, rekeying typically costs less than swapping out every lock for new hardware. It is often recommended after moves, employee departures, lost keys, and thrift-oriented remodels.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; How rekeying compares to replacing locks.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Rekeying is usually cheaper but not always the right solution. Choose replacement when the lock lacks Grade 1 or 2 security, when keys are broken inside, or when you want a freshly rated cylinder. For typical houses and apartments, rekeying provides an acceptable security upgrade without the expense of new locks.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; A step-by-step look at an on-site rekey.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The first step the locksmith takes is an inspection to ensure the cylinder can be rekeyed safely. If the cylinder is serviceable they will remove it, swap pins to match a new key code, and test the operation. A standard residential single-cylinder deadbolt often takes 15 to 30 minutes to rekey on-site.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; How much does rekeying cost in Orlando and what factors influence it.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Typical pricing for a single-cylinder residential rekey is commonly in the low to mid ranges, depending on travel and time. If security is critical, inquire about restricted key systems and master keying options ahead of time.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Real-world examples and decision stories.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A landlord with a six-unit property saved several hundred dollars by rekeying after turnover rather than replacing dozens of locks. An owner who found milled marks on the cylinder moved to full replacement because rekeying would not remove the physical vulnerabilities. Both outcomes are common; you must weigh cost against long-term risk and policy requirements.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Practical steps to prevent repeating key headaches.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Label new keys carefully and record who receives copies to avoid uncontrolled duplication. Restricted keys raise the bar on casual duplication and help when access control matters. Small investments in key tracking pay &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://extra-wiki.win/index.php/Residential_Rekey_Near_Me_Orlando&amp;quot;&amp;gt;Florida locksmith&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; off when tenants move or employees leave.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; When master keying is appropriate and how it affects rekeying.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Use master key systems when you need one-person access plus controlled sub-keys for &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://sticky-wiki.win/index.php/24/7_Auto_Locksmith_Orlando_for_Ignition_Repair&amp;quot;&amp;gt;emergency locksmith 24 hours&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; others. Master keying adds complexity to the rekey and slightly increases cost because of the planning and pinning involved. Avoid master keying if you only have a couple of doors and no operational need for hierarchical access.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; How emergency locksmith calls differ from regular rekey jobs.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; After-hours or emergency responses usually cost more because technicians leave routine scheduling to respond quickly. If you are locked out, an auto or residential locksmith can gain entry and then recommend rekeying if keys are missing or compromised.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; When to call an auto locksmith instead of a residential locksmith.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Car key replacement often means programming transponders or cutting new blanks rather than swapping pin stacks in door cylinders. If you need a simple mechanical key cut for an older vehicle, a mobile auto locksmith can usually arrive and cut a working key on-site. Accurate vehicle information shortens the call and prevents a wasted trip when special equipment is required.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Small investments that improve protection after rekeying.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Physical reinforcement complements a fresh key system and is inexpensive compared with full hardware replacement.
